Knud Olaf Holm (2 January 1887 in Copenhagen, Denmark – 28 May 1972 in Copenhagen, Denmark) was a Danish gymnast who competed in the 1906 Summer Olympics and in the 1908 Summer Olympics.[1]
At the 1906 Summer Olympics in Athens, he was a member of the Danish gymnastics team, which won the silver medal in the team, Swedish system event. Two years later, he was part of the Danish team, which finished fourth in the team competition.[2]
He was the brother of fellow Olympic participant Poul Holm and Aage Holm.
